[0060] The present invention will be further described below in conjunction with the drawings.
[0061] Reference attached figure 1 The specific implementation steps of the present invention are as follows:
[0062] Step 1. Input image data.
[0063] Input the main image data and auxiliary image data respectively obtained by the main and auxiliary antennas of the polarization interference synthetic aperture radar into the system. The input main image data and auxiliary image data are the imaging results of the same area, so as to ensure the coherence between the main image and the auxiliary image.
[0064] Step 2. Rough image registration.
[0065] Using the InSAR coarse registration method, the main image and the auxiliary image are coarsely registered. In the process of image coarse registration, the registration accuracy is only required to reach the pixel level, which greatly reduces the difficulty of image coarse registration.
